Q: Why should I move my website? What does website migration entail?

A: When your present hosting provider can no longer satisfy the necessities of your web site, or when you face regular downtime, or if you are made to wait for hours for the help desk staff to respond to you, it may be a good idea to swap your web hosting provider, i.e. to move all the files for your websites together with your databases from your current provider to your future provider. Q: Will my site be offline during the transfer?

A: Your website will continue to work exactly like it did before with your former web hosting provider. Once we are done with the migration, your site will be configured to work on our web hosting platform and we will ask you to preview it. If it is working properly, all you will have to do is update the name server records for your domain. Your website will be transferred to us with no downtime whatsoever.

Q: Does it matter what platform my current hosting provider is using?

A: We support all Linux–driven hosting platforms. Fundamentally, if we can acquire access to your Control Panel, we’ll be able to transfer your site.The only platforms that we do not support are closed–source web site creation platforms such as Wix, BaseKit, Jimdo, Website Tonight, Four Square, Mr Site, etc.
